System Requirements for Servicing Director 16.3
This article details supported environments for Servicing Director servers, clients, and interfaces.
Client
- Microsoft Windows Vista (32-bit and 64-bit)
- Microsoft Windows 7 (32-bit and 64-bit)
Microsoft Windows 8 (32-bit and 64-bit) - Microsoft Windows 8.1 (32-bit and 64-bit)
- Processor 1.0 GHz or faster, 1GB memory, 3GB hard drive space (disk space requirements will vary; if you archive documents on the client, you may need more space)
- Microsoft Word 2007, 2010 or 2013
- Microsoft Installer 4.5 or later
- Additional required Windows updates available from Microsoft (the Servicing Director installation will install these if not present):
- Microsoft .NET Framework 4.0
- Visual C++ Redistributable for Visual Studio 2015 (x86) - 14.0.23026
- Microsoft SQL Server 2008 R2 Native Client 10 (2009.100.1600.1) or later (x64 or 86, as applicable)
- Crystal Reports for Visual Studio 2010 Run Time version 13.0.15.1840 available from SAP
- Laser printer: Servicing Director supports most Windows-compatible printers
- Adobe Reader for viewing PDF format documents; free download at www.adobe.com
- (Optional) SAP Crystal Reports XI or 2013 user edition for the PC (if you design reports)
- Thin client technologies such as Terminal Services/Remote Desktop Services/Citrix XenApp/VDI are NOT supported
Server
- Microsoft Windows Server 2008 (32-bit and 64-bit) with Windows 2008 Service Pack 2
- Microsoft Windows Server 2008 R2
- Microsoft Windows Server 2012
-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2 - IMPORTANT! If you are installing Servicing Director 16.2 on Microsoft Windows Server 2012 R2, you must apply Microsoft Update #2919355 to the server. Access the Microsoft knowledge base for more information about this update.
- Processor 2.0 GHz or faster, 4GB memory (should be increased as database size increases to ensure optimal performance), 6GB hard drive space (disk space requirements will vary; estimate 1GB of hard disk space for every 1000 loans; if you archive documents on the server, you may need more space)
- SMTP server access is required for Servicing Director automated emails
- SQL Server:
- SQL Server 2008, SQL Server 2008 R2, SQL Server 2012; Express, Standard, or Enterprise editions; (x86 or x64)
- The SQL collation sequence must be SQL_Latin1_General_CP1_CI_AS; this is set during the SQL Server installation and cannot be changed
- SQL Server Cluster servers are not supported for Servicing Director. The Servicing Director database is not tested or designed for a SQL Cluster server.
- SQL Server database replication is not supported for Servicing Director. The Servicing Director database is not tested or designed for a database with replication enabled.
- Microsoft Installer 4.5 or later
- Additional required Windows updates available from Microsoft (the Servicing Director installation will install these if not present, but a reboot may be required before the Servicing Director installation can continue):
- Microsoft .NET Framework 4.0
- Visual C++ Redistributable for Visual Studio 2015 (x86) - 14.0.23026
- Microsoft SQL Server 2008 System CLR Types 10.00.2531.00 (x86), and (x64) on Windows 64-bit systems, from the SQL 2008 Service Pack 3 Feature Pack (required regardless of version of SQL Server database engine)
- Microsoft SQL Server 2008 Management Objects 10.00.2531.01 (x86), and (x64) on Windows 64-bit systems, from the SQL 2008 Service Pack 3 Feature Pack (required regardless of version of SQL Server database engine)
- Microsoft System CLR Types for Microsoft SQL Server 2012 SP1 (x86), and (x64) on Windows 64-bit systems, from the SQL 2012 Service Pack 1 Feature Pack (required regardless of version of SQL Server database engine)
- Microsoft SQL Server 2012 SP1 Shared Management Objects (x86), and (x64) on Windows 64-bit systems, from the SQL 2012 Service Pack 1 Feature Pack (required regardless of version of SQL Server database engine)
- Internet connectivity and browser for downloading and installing product updates and patches as needed and used to support interfaces
IMPORTANT! Servicing Director cannot be installed on a Microsoft domain controller.
Virtualization
Servicing Director is supported in a virtualized infrastructure. A technical conference call will be scheduled prior to your installation; this call includes network configuration review, analysis, and formal recommendation.
